Wet Core Drills for Concrete & Reinforced Applications

Most diamond core drilling applications benefit from wet core bits, which use water to:

  • Cool the segments

  • Flush slurry from the cut

  • Extend tool life

  • Maintain consistent cutting speed

Wet drilling is ideal for structural concrete, bridge decks, foundations, tilt-wall panels, and commercial slab work where precision and efficiency matter.
